All Macs come with a Hardware Test CD which can diagnose most basic hardware problems. TechTool from Micromat ( www.micromat.com ) can also be used to test the CPU, RAM, hard drive, etc. If you get an AppleCare extended warranty for your Mac, TechTool is included on the CD.

DiskWarrior for the hard disk.
TechTool Pro if you want to check other hardware like RAM and the like. However, TTP's hard disk tests aren't great.
